What is TMJ?

The temporomandibular joint, or TMJ for short, is a crucial and complex part of the human body. Located where the jawbone connects to the skull, this joint is responsible for various facial movements, including speaking, laughing, eating, and yawning. While it may seem like a simple hinge joint at first glance, the TMJ contains several intricate structures, such as ligaments, cartilage, and muscles, that work together to facilitate these movements. Unfortunately, this complexity also makes the TMJ susceptible to various problems, such as arthritis, injury, and stress. Understanding how this joint works can help prevent and alleviate such issues, making it an essential topic for anyone interested in caring for their oral health.

What are the Symptoms of TMJ Disorder?

TMJ disorder is a condition that affects millions of people worldwide. While the exact cause of this disorder is still unclear, several factors are believed to play a role in its development. One of the leading causes of TMJ disorder is prolonged clenching or grinding of teeth, also known as bruxism. This puts excessive pressure on the TMJ, leading to inflammation and pain. Trauma to the jaw or joint is another common cause of TMJ disorder, which can be caused by a blow to the face, a car accident, or a sports injury. Arthritis, stress, and poor posture are other factors that can contribute to the development of TMJ disorder. Understanding these causes is essential for effectively treating and preventing this common condition.

How Can a Custom-Fit Night Guard Help You Manage TMJ Symptoms?

TMJ pain can be a nuisance for many individuals, often leading to discomfort and inconvenience. A convenient way to alleviate this pain is by using night guards. Night guards are designed to prevent your teeth from grinding or clenching during sleep, one of the biggest culprits of TMJ pain. Using a night guard dramatically reduces the tension in your jaw, allowing your muscles to relax and have a restful night’s sleep. This can lead to fewer headaches, less clicking or popping when you open your jaw, and an overall reduction in pain.
